The Executive Access Model (EAM): A Classroom Framework for Understanding Variability in Student Performance
Abstract
The Executive Access Model (EAM) is an applied instructional framework that translates a constraint based control architecture of human functioning into observable classroom practice. It explains variability in student performance as changes in executive access, defined as the moment to moment ability to initiate, sustain, shift, manage cognitive load, and regulate under classroom demands, rather than deficits in skill, motivation, or ability. The model organizes executive functioning into five domains: Activation, Persistence, Switching (Cognitive Flexibility), Cognitive Load and Working Memory, and Threat and Regulation. Within each domain, EAM identifies observable classroom patterns, provides operational definitions, and aligns them with targeted instructional supports. The framework is designed for use across general and special education settings, aligns with Multi Tiered Systems of Support, and emphasizes real time instructional adjustment based on observable changes in access. By shifting the central instructional question from “Why won’t this student do the work?” to “What is interfering with access right now?”, the model supports more precise and consistent responses to learning barriers. This work presents the framework, domain structure, pattern classifications, and implementation procedures for classroom use.
